Judge rules that victims of deadly Boeing 737 MAX crashes are victims of a CRIME - which will allow families of those who died on board to file new lawsuits against the company
2022-10-23
  • The first Max crashed in Indonesia in October 2018, killing 189, and another crashed five months later in Ethiopia, killing 157

  • Boeing, which misled safety regulators who approved the Max, agreed in January 2021 to pay $2.5 billion - including a $243.6 million fine

  • A judge in Fort Worth, Texas, has now said the crashes were a foreseeable consequence of Boeing's conspiracy

  • His ruling means the relatives are representatives of crime victims - but the full impact of the ruling is not yet known
